Output d49589e227d1e362a28d984abf33c24d127987c9aece0a8d0eea79ebd3a641e1:1

value
11524436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ba52082329b2814028756d023ed9a97edbc138f OP_EQUAL
address
3PAzXr9BC7TxKqSFAVVSw9d6d1WkEdQkPL
transaction
d49589e227d1e362a28d984abf33c24d127987c9aece0a8d0eea79ebd3a641e1
spent
true